Download as pdf or txt
Download as pdf or txt
You are on page 1of 3

TRẮC NGHIỆM HỆ ĐIỀU HÀNH

CHƯƠNG 01. GIỚI THIỆU

Câu 01. Mục tiêu chính của việc hiện thực bộ nhớ đệm trong tương tác với thiết
bị I/O?
A. Tăng hiệu suất sử dụng thiết bị I/O
B. Tăng tốc độ đọc/ghi của bộ nhớ chính
C. Tăng tốc độ tần số xung nhịp của CPU
D. Mở rộng kích thước của bộ nhớ chính

Câu 02. Chọn câu đúng về Hệ điều hành?


A. Phần cứng máy tính, chương trình hệ thống, chương trình ứng dụng và người sử
dụng
B. Phần mềm cung cấp các dịch vụ cơ bản cho các ứng dụng
C. Chương trình ứng dụng
D. Phần mềm trung gian giữa phần cứng máy tính và ứng dụng của người sử
dụng

CHƯƠNG 02. OPERATING SYSTEM STRUCTURES

Câu 01. Các chức năng của Hệ điều hành là:


A. Phối hợp và đồng bộ hoạt động gữa các quá trình.
B. Định thời CPU
C. Cung cấp giao diện nhập dữ liệu thuận tiện cho người dùng
D. Quản lý bộ nhớ

Câu 02. Chọn câu đúng:


A. Multiprogramming làm giảm hiệu suất sử dụng (CPU utilization) còn time-sharing
thì làm tăng hiệu suất sử dụng CPU
B. Hệ thống Multiprogramming không cung cấp khả năng tương tác hiệu quả với
người dùng, còn time-sharing cung cấp khả năng tương tác hiệu quả với người
dùng.
C. Multiprogramming giữ nhiều công việc trong bộ nhớ còn time-sharing chỉ giữ một.

Câu 03. Chọn phát biểu đúng về cấu trúc monolithic:


A. Các dịch vụ của hệ điều hành được tích hợp vào kernel.
B. Việc trao đổi dữ liệu giữa các thành phần chức năng của kernel thực hiện chủ yếu
bằng cơ chế message-passing.
C. Việc thêm các chức năng của hệ điều hành được thực hiện dễ dàng hơn so với cấu
trúc microkernel.

Câu 04. Theo sơ đồ hệ thống lưu trữ (Storage-device hierarchy) thứ tự tốc độ
tăng dần từ trái qua là: Register, cache, disk, main memory, tapes. Đúng hay sai?
A. Đúng
B. Sai

Câu 05. MS DOS và UNIX đều là cấu trúc dạng hệ thống đơn (monolithic) và có
thể phân lớp?
A. Đúng
B. Sai

Câu 06. Giao diện cung cấp để truy cập các dịch vụ của hệ điều hành thông qua:
A. Application Programming Interface (API)
B. Thư viện hàm (library)
C. Gọi hệ thống (System calls)
D. Các lệnh mã máy (assembly instructions)

Câu 07. Quá trình (process) là:


A. Một chương trình đang thực thi.
B. Một thủ tục/hàm trong một chương trình.
C. Một tập tin nhị phân (binary file).
D. Một chương trình có thể thực thi (executable program) được.

Câu 08. Hệ điều hành Linux có kiến trúc lõi nào sau đây:
A. Layered kernel.
B. Microkernel.
C. Purely monolithic.
D. Monolithic modular kernel.

Câu 09. Cơ chế phân chia thời gian (time-sharing) cho các công việc/ứng dụng
thích hợp với kiểu hệ thống:
A. Hệ thống hướng giao diện (Interactive system)
B. Hệ thống dạng bó (Batch system).
C. Hệ thống thời gian thực (Real time system).
D. Hệ thống đơn lập trình (Uniprogramming system).

Câu 10. Chức năng quản lý hệ điều hành bao gồm:


A. Quản lý hệ thống file.
B. Quản lý quá trình (process).
C. Quản lý bộ nhớ.
D. Quản lý thời gian làm việc của người dùng.

You might also like